Oisha

A modern name with South Asian roots, possibly derived from Sanskrit or Bengali elements suggesting brightness or distinctiveness. Oisha has a lyrical, contemporary quality that appeals to multicultural families seeking a name that sounds fresh yet grounded in cultural tradition. The name carries an elegant, spirited character.
